What Drugs Interact With Bismuth Subsalicylate To Avoid? Are you aware of how certain medications can interact with each other and affect your health? In this informative video, we’ll explain the important drug interactions to watch out for when using bismuth subsalicylate. We’ll start by discussing why it’s essential to know which medicines may cause problems when combined with this common gastrointestinal treatment. We’ll cover the risks associated with blood thinners, aspirin, antibiotics, NSAIDs, and medications for gout and diabetes, highlighting how these combinations could lead to adverse effects or reduced effectiveness. Additionally, we’ll explain why certain groups, such as individuals with bleeding disorders or recovering from viral infections, need to exercise caution with bismuth subsalicylate.
